Provides rides for any purpose, as long as you meet one of the following criteria: you have a disability.

The In-Home Care program offers convenient transportation services for older adults who require assistance getting to appointments, running errands, or attending social activities. With the option of being chauffeured in a car, older adults can enjoy a comfortable and reliable mode of transportation to stay connected with their community. The pricing for this program is flexible and varies based on the specific services needed, ensuring that older adults only pay for what they use. To utilize this service, older adults are encouraged to schedule their rides in advance, allowing them to plan their trips efficiently and ensuring that a driver will be available to assist them. By booking transportation a few days ahead of time, older adults can have peace of mind knowing that their mobility needs are taken care of, enabling them to maintain their independence and continue participating in activities that enrich their lives. Whether it's a medical appointment, a visit to a friend, or a shopping trip, the In-Home Care program is designed to make transportation easy and accessible for older adults.
